The paper deals with a method to calculate the stable-unbalanced response of a multirotor system,supported on Square Film Damper (SFD) and engaged with the tapered gears,to bending and torsioning vibrations.The influence of SFD and engaging gear of an abnormal structure engine rotor on the stable-unbalanced response of bending and torsion coupling has been studied.A transfer matrix is deduced which is able to determine the gear's unstable response to engaging forces (in 3 directions) and torque.The transfer matrix couples bend and torsion between not only tapered gears,but also abnormal structure and engine shaft.A formula is set up for calculating the potential energy,kinetic energy and energy distribution in the multirotor system.A general computer program is worked out to calculate the engery and the stable-unbalanced response of the multirotor with the tapered gear and SFD.
